ORDER
This Writ Petition has been filed to direct the respondents to consider the petitioner's representation, dated 26.02.2021 and consequently direct them to regularize the service from initial date of my appointment on 12.07.2004 to 01.06.2006 and to provide all consequential monetary and service benefits.
2.The grievance of the Writ Petitioner is that he was originally appointed to the post of B.T Assistant on temporary basis during the year 2003-2004. In order to regularize the service from the initial date of appointment and to provide consequential monetary and service benefits, the petitioner has given a representation, dated 26.02.2021 to the respondents, however, the same has not been considered. Hence, seeks direction of this Court.
3.On perusal of the records, it is seen that earlier, this Court in W.P.No.4991 of 2016, dated 30.07.2019 (T.Kunju Krishnan and others Versus Government of Tamil Nadu, Rep. by its Secretary, School Education Department, Fort St.George, Chennai-600 009) gave direction Page No.2 of 5
to regularize the service of the persons therein from the date of entry into the service for the purpose of seniority and extend all the monetary benefits flowing thereof, if any. Citing the same order, dated 30.07.2019, this Court again in W.P.No.27923 of 2019 gave direction for regularization of service from the date of entry into the service for the purpose of seniority and extend all the monetary benefits flowing thereof, if any. On the strength of the same, the present Writ Petition has been filed. 4.Considering the facts and circumstances of the case and the issue is squarely covered by the decision of this Court in W.P.No.4991 of 2016, dated 30.07.2019 (T.Kunju Krishnan and others Versus Government of Tamil Nadu, Rep. by its Secretary, School Education Department, Fort St.George, Chennai-600 009), the respondents shall consider the representation of the petitioner, dated 26.02.2021 in the light of the said decision and pass orders on merits, within a period of three months from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.

5.With the above direction, this Writ Petition is disposed of. No costs.
